CR4 1AX is a safe, established residential area on Firs Close, 0.3km from Eastfields in Merton. Administratively it sits within Longthornton ward and the Mitcham and Morden constituency.

For families considering a move, CR4 1AX represents a working-class neighbourhood with strong employment ties. The daytime character shifts — ethnically mixed self-employed with no fixed place of work in construction, transport, and storage. The 37 average age reflects a mixed, mid-career community — settling down but not yet slowing down. 59% of properties are owner-occupied — a strong indicator of neighbourhood stability and long-term community investment. The area has a notably diverse population — 64% of residents identify as non-white, reflecting the multicultural character of this part of Merton.

Safety: Crime rates are low here at 42 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Average house prices are around £228k, down 3.2% year-on-year.

Census 2021 statistics for CR4 1AX are sourced from Output Area E00017266 (shared with 3 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
